Are you RoHS Compliant?
The impact that RoHS will have on engineering designs and product deployment could include:
- RoHS may require a requalification of a design using the RoHS compliant parts
- A design may have to be re-engineered to support the RoHS compliant parts
- The different chemical makeup of RoHS parts may require an additional “learning curve” for PCB assembly houses to re-tool soldering processes
